服务器监控是确保服务器正常运行和性能优化的重要环节。关键性能指标包括CPU使用率、内存使用率、磁盘I/O、网络流量等。通过收集这些指标,可以及时发现潜在问题并采取相应措施。最佳实践包括定期检查系统日志、设置阈值报警、优化配置文件等。编写自动化的服务器监控脚本可以实现持续监控和自动报告,提高运维效率。
本文目录导读:
在当今的信息化社会,服务器监控已经成为企业 IT 运维的重要组成部分,通过对服务器的性能、资源使用情况、安全状况等进行实时监控,可以有效地提高服务器的稳定性和可靠性,降低故障发生的风险,从而保障企业的业务正常运行,本文将详细介绍服务器监控的关键性能指标以及一些最佳实践,帮助您更好地了解和实施服务器监控。
关键性能指标
1、CPU 使用率:CPU 使用率是衡量服务器性能的重要指标之一,通过监控 CPU 使用率,可以了解服务器的负载情况,及时发现潜在的性能瓶颈。
2、内存使用率:内存使用率反映了服务器的内存使用情况,过高的内存使用率可能导致内存泄漏或者系统不稳定,定期检查内存使用率并采取相应的优化措施是必要的。
3、磁盘 I/O:磁盘 I/O 是影响服务器性能的关键因素之一,通过监控磁盘 I/O,可以了解服务器的读写速度,找出潜在的性能问题。
4、网络流量:网络流量是衡量服务器网络性能的重要指标,通过监控网络流量,可以了解服务器的网络带宽使用情况,及时发现网络拥堵或者安全漏洞。
5、虚拟内存:虚拟内存是操作系统为了解决物理内存不足而引入的一种技术,通过监控虚拟内存的使用情况,可以了解服务器的内存管理状况,找出可能导致系统崩溃的问题。
最佳实践
1、选择合适的监控工具:市场上有很多优秀的服务器监控工具,如 Zabbix、Nagios、Prometheus 等,根据企业的实际需求和预算,选择合适的监控工具是非常重要的。
2、设定合理的阈值:为了确保服务器的稳定运行,需要为关键性能指标设定合理的阈值,可以将 CPU 使用率限制在 80% 以内,将内存使用率限制在 70% 以内等。
3、建立报警机制:当关键性能指标超过设定的阈值时,应该立即启动报警机制,通知相关人员进行处理,这样可以避免因为临时性的性能问题导致系统崩溃。
4、定期分析日志:通过分析服务器的日志,可以发现潜在的问题和异常行为,建议定期对服务器日志进行审查和分析。
5、及时更新硬件和软件:随着时间的推移,服务器的硬件和软件可能会出现各种问题,建议定期检查服务器的硬件和软件状态,并及时进行更新和维护。
6、建立备份策略:为了防止数据丢失,建议为服务器建立备份策略,这样即使发生故障,也可以快速恢复数据。
服务器监控是一项复杂而重要的工作,通过掌握关键性能指标和实施最佳实践,您可以更好地保障服务器的稳定运行,为企业创造更多的价值。